Lubiewo, Kuyavian-Pomeranian Voivodeship
Village in Kuyavian-Pomeranian Voivodeship, Poland
53°28′1″N 18°1′6″E / 53.46694°N 18.01833°E / 53.46694; 18.01833Lubiewo (Polish pronunciation: [luˈbjɛvɔ]) is a village in Tuchola County, Kuyavian-Pomeranian Voivodeship, in north-central Poland.[1] It is the seat of the gmina (administrative district) called Gmina Lubiewo. It lies approximately 19 kilometres (12 mi) south-east of Tuchola and 39 km (24 mi) north of Bydgoszcz.
